Order Entry
Switzerland
ContactUsLinkComponent
NANDROLONE DECANOATE 1 * 10 mg
Catalog # PROOLGCFOR0982.00
NANDROLONE DECANOATE 1 * 10 mg
Catalog # PROOLGCFOR0982.00
Frequently Bought Together